Here's a question...Ive been having issues for some time with Comfort
and
the tel line and also the fact I wanted to turn off the ringer when in
night mode.

I spent an hour trying to figure out why the phone still rang, and once I
pulled the ringer cable from the master socket, I knew something was odd !
Ive got phones over cat5, using 586A.

Turns out, my Panasonic DECT phone is creating it's own ringer - a normal
cheapy phone in the same socket wont ring, but this Panny will. Im
thinking that perhaps this phone is also the cause of phantom 'calls' and
Comfort is picking up the telephone line thinking someone has called.

I cant see in the manual about any self generating ringer...anyone got any
thoughts on this ?
